
SPSS操作步骤汇总.docx
12页SPSS 学习第一章 数据文件的建立数据编码Type: Numeric:数值型 string:字符串型Missing:Measure: scale 定量变量 nominal 定性变量根据已有的变量建立新变量1、 对于数据进行重新编码Transform—recode into different variables—选择 input variable output variable 一定义新变量的 名称一change—开始定义新旧变量一continue2、 通过SPSS函数建立新变量Transform—compute variable-从 function group中选择公式范围 下面选择具体的公式一if中设置要改变一continue—OK(可以对变量进行各种计算)第二章 清除数据与基本统计分析1、 对不合理的数据检查并清理检查:analysis-description statistic-frequencies—选入要检查的数据一OK结果:频数统计表一看是否有错误一missing system清理:1. 对系统缺失值的清理Data—select case—if condition is satisfied—if—function group( missing)--下面选(missing)--continue—output (delete unselected cases)--OK—对 num 为哪一位的进行修改2. 对 sex=3 的清理(直接就清除了)Data—select case—if condition is satisfied—if—sex 调入再输入=3—continue-- output (delete unselected cases)--OK—对 num 为哪一位的进行修改2. 对相关变量间逻辑性检查和清理Data—select case—if condition is satisfied—i f—输入表达式(前后逻辑不相符合的表达 式)--continue-- output (delete unselected cases)--OK—对 num 为哪一位的进行修 改3. 统计描述正态分布统计描述1、正态性检验: Analysis—nonparametric tests—legacy dialogs—1-sample K-S—one-sampleKolomogorov Smirnov test-normal—ok/2、 统计描述:Analysis—descriptives--time 选入一options—ok3、 按照男女统计描述:data—split file -compare group-sex 调入一okAnalysis-descriptive statistic 一 descriptive—time 调入一options 选择一OK非正态分布资料统计描述1、 正态性检验 nonparametric2、 Analysis—descriptive statistics—frequencies 选入--statistics 选择一OK第三章 T 检验1、 单样本 t 检验正态性检验一analyze—compare means—one-sample t test—test value 选择要对比的数值一OK2、 配对样本t检验建立数据文档一两列(前和后)--正态性检验一analysis- compare means—paired sample t test -调入一ok3、 两独立样本t检验(正态性检验的时候采用分开组,其他都要合并在一起建立数据库一第一列(group)第二列(数值)--data—split file-compare group—调入 group—ok- 正态性检验一OK-- data—split file—选择 analysis all—analyze—compare means—independent sample t test—选入,分组一OK结果分方差齐与否第四章 方差分析(前提正态)1、 单因素方差分析(就是平常的三个组比较) 建立数据库一第一列(group)第二列(数值)-data—split file-compare group—调入 group—ok-正 态性检验—OK-- data—split file—选 择 analysis all--analyze—comparemeans—one-way-anova—数据调入 dependent list —分组调入 factor options—descriptive 基 本统计描述一homogeneity of variance做方差齐性分析一OK2、 方差分析两两比较analyze—compare means—one-way-anova---数据调入 dependent list—分组调入 factor—点 post hoc—选择 SNK LSD3、 随机区组设计方差分析建立数据库一第一列(group)第二列(block)第三列(数值)--按照group split开,进行正 态性检验一OK—general liner model—univairate—数值调入 dependent variable—group 和 block 调入 fixed factor—model—custom—build terms( main effects) 再把 group 和 block 调入 model 下的矩形框---continue—OK如果区组间无差别,组间进行两两比较。
首先进行方差齐性检验:Option—调入一homogentity test—continue—ok分析:univariate — post hoc—univariate—调入 group—SNK LSD—continue—ok4、 多因素分析以time为观察值分析pt、da、sex间的差别General liner model—univariate—time(dependent variance), pt 、 da 、 sex(fix factor)—model—mian factors—调入一continue—OK—将无关的逐一排除一选择出最终有差异 的—求得 R square第五章 卡方检验1、 行 x 列卡方检验(也就是几组数据差异性比较) 输入数据—第一列(列123)—第二列(行1234)—第三列(频数)定义频数变量:Data—weight case—调入频数分 析 : analyze—descriptive statistics—crosstabs— 第 一 行 调 入 row— 第 二 列 调 入 column---statistics—选择 chi-square—continue -cells 选项一选择 row—ok结果中,最后一行英文,理论值小于5 的各数和最小理论值如果有统计学意义,可以进行两两比较:在数据设置那里,找到missing value—discrete missing value下的格子中填入3 (表示把3取 掉了,只是1和2进行比较)--后续操作同上2、 四格表卡方检验 输入数据—第一列(处理因素)—第二列(疗效)—第三列(频数)定义频数变量:Data—weight case—调入频数分 析 : analyze—descriptive statistics—crosstabs— 第 一 行 调 入 row— 第 二 列 调 入 column---statistics—选择 chi-square—continue-cells 选项一选择 row、expected—ok结果中,最后一行英文,理论值小于5的各数和最小理论值。
确切概论法,continuity correction 表示校正卡方的结果Ps:诸如第一个例题中,如果分析性别与感染率的显著性差异,步骤同四个表卡方检验,由于分开写了,不用转换为频数资料而已3、 配对卡方检验输入数据一第一列(a)—第二列(b)—第三列(频数)定义频数变量:Data—weight case—调入频数分析方法一:analyze—nonparametric—legacy dialogy--2-related sample tested—a 和 b 分别选 入配对—激活下列的选项 McNemar分析方 法二:analyze—descriptive statistics—crosstabs—ab 填 入—statistics—点 击右下 McNemar—ok第六章 秩和检验1、 配对秩和检验(定量)输入数据—第一列(前) —第二列(后)分析:analyze—nonparametric—legacy dialogy--2-related sample tested—a 和 b 分别选入配对结果:第一个表格是比较大小的数量,第二个表格是统计分析结果两独立样本比较秩和检验(定量)输入数据一第一列(group)—第二列(数值)分析:analyze—nonparametric—legacy dialogy --2 independent samples—输入分析的数据和分 组情况一OK2、 有序变量两独立样本比较秩和检验(定性)输入数据一第一列(group)一第二列(有序变量)--第三列(频率)定义频数变量:Data—weight case—调入频数分析:analyze—nonparametric—legacy dialogy --2 independent samples—有序变量调入 test variables list—group 调入分组并定义一ok多个独立样本的比较(定量)比如:甲乙丙三个样本进行比较输入数据一第一列(group)—第二列(数值)nalyze—nonparametric—legacy dialogy --K independent samples-数值调入 test variable test—group 调入分组矩形框给出分组范围 1-3—Ok如果差别有统计学意义,那么进行两两比较,方法参考卡方的两两表,用missing来定义第七章 相关与回归第一节 一元线性回归1、 例题:有 12 组发硒值和血硒值的含量表输入数据—第一列(发硒) —第二列(血硒)分析:正态性检验,相关和回归的前提是正态性正态性检验: Analysis—nonparametric tests—legacy dialogs—1-sample K-S—one-sample Kolomogorov Smirnov test-normal—ok相关分析:correlate—Bivariate—Bivariate correlation—服从正态分布的选择 pearson,不 服从的选择 spearman回归分析 : regression—regression—linear— 将 y 变量调入 dependent, x 变量调入 independent---statistics—linear regression—选择 descriptive—OK结果分析:p值V0.05差别有统计学意义,可以建立回归方程2、 频数资料的相关与回归建立数据库一第一列(x)—第二列(y)—第三列(f)分析:先将频数通过 weight case 进行操作Analyze—regression—linear—选入自变量因变量一OKPs:这样的回归模型有常数项,也可以去掉,options—include constant in eq。
